2d5eeffa8eb13983f54d7170dde02d29a6278abe
[u/mrichter/AliRoot.git] / ITS / AliITSv1.h
1 #ifndef ITSv1_H
2 #define ITSv1_H
3 /* Copyright(c) 1998-1999, ALICE Experiment at CERN, All rights reserved. *
4  * See cxx source for full Copyright notice                               */
5
6 /* $Id$ */
7
8 /////////////////////////////////////////////////////////
9 //  Manager and hits classes for set: ITS version 1    //
10 /////////////////////////////////////////////////////////
11  
12 #include "AliITS.h"
13  
14 class AliITSv1 : public AliITS {
15
16 private:
17     Int_t fId1N; // The number of layers for geometry version 5
18     // The name of the layers as defined in the Geant tree.
19     char  **fId1Name;
20  
21 public:
22   AliITSv1();
23   AliITSv1(const char *name, const char *title);
24   virtual       ~AliITSv1() ;
25   virtual void   CreateGeometry();
26   virtual void   CreateMaterials();
27   virtual void   Init(); 
28   virtual Int_t  IsVersion() const {return 1;}
29   virtual void   DrawModule();
30   virtual void   StepManager();
31   
32    ClassDef(AliITSv1,1)  //Hits manager for set:ITS version 1
33 };
34  
35 #endif